Output bb59b66dbe04ef64bacbbd98baf446b3a232e394b18a03299cecb431cec51acf:5

value
8312626
script pubkey
OP_0 OP_PUSHBYTES_20 be5ed654d70f3fb63e5be3c012bfc51dbb9ce58e
address
bc1qhe0dv4xhpulmv0jmu0qp9079rkaeeevwdqqwz3
transaction
bb59b66dbe04ef64bacbbd98baf446b3a232e394b18a03299cecb431cec51acf
spent
true